Evan Rachel Wood And Reeve Carney To Star In Live Music of Tarantino Concert

2019 marks the 25th anniversary of Quentin Tarantino's masterpiece, Pulp Fiction. To celebrate, Hollywood's raucous concert troupe, 'For The Record,' is taking their show on the road. Just in time for their eight-year anniversary, For The Record returns to The Sorting Room at Wallis Annenberg Center for the Performing Arts July 12 - 15 to reinvent the hit that started it all. For The Record: Tarantino.

From Reservoir Dogs to The Hateful Eight, Quentin Tarantino's iconic style and vintage soundtracks are the gold standard of retro cool. For The Record: Tarantino is a rock 'n' soul concert that brings to life Tarantino's cinematic universe. It's a spiderweb of hitmen, gangsters and assassins slaying vinyl classics like - "Son of a Preacher Man," "Stuck in the Middle With You," "Bang Bang," and many more - to create a genre-defying musical tribute to the genre-defining director. This incarnation is led by a quintet of superheroines inspired by the powerful women of Tarantino's dysfunctional family tree. Straight out of Tarantino's graphic novel, these women battle "The Tyranny of Evil Men" as 'THE FOX FORCE FIVE.'

Evan Rachel Wood leads 'THE FOX FORCE FIVE' as 'THE BLONDE FOX' (inspired by 'Mia Wallace' from Pulp Fiction and 'Beatrix Kiddo' from Kill Bill: Vol. 1 & 2). She's joined by Reeve Carney (character inspired by 'Vincent Vega' from Pulp Fiction and 'Dr. King Schultz' from Django Unchained) and Ty Taylor (character inspired by 'Jules Winnfield' from Pulp Fiction and 'Ordell Robbie' from Jackie Brown). The other 'FOXES' will be brought to life by the powerhouse vocals of Dionne Gipson (character inspired by Jackie Brown & 'Vernita Green' from Kill Bill: Vol. 1 & 2), Olivia Kuper Harris (character inspired by 'Fabienne' from Pulp Fiction and 'Shosanna Dreyfus' from Inglourious Basterds), Carrie Manolakos (character inspired by 'Butterfly' from Death Proof and 'Santanico Pandemonium' from From Dusk Till Dawn)and TV Carpio (character inspired by 'Oren Ishii' from Kill Bill: Vol. 1 & 2). Battling alongside the 'FOXES' are dynamos James Byous (character inspired by 'Butch Coolidge' from Pulp Fiction and 'Lt. Aldo Raine' from Inglourious Basterds), Rogelio Douglas, Jr. (character inspired by 'Marsellus Wallace' from Pulp Fiction, 'Joe Cabot' from Reservoir Dogs, and 'Django' from Django Unchained) and Patrick Mulvey (character inspired by 'Col. Hans Landa' from Inglourious Basterds, 'Bill' from Kill Bill: Vol. 1 & 2, & 'Stuntman Mike' from Death Proof).

For The Record: Tarantino will be directed by Anderson Davis, with musical supervision and arrangements by Jesse Vargas, vocal design by Tony Nominee AnnMarie Milazzo, lighting design by Michael Berger, sound design by Ben Soldate, costume design by Steve Mazurek, and co-produced by Shane Scheel and Siobhan O'Neill. About FOR THE RECORD:

Created by Shane Scheel and Anderson Davis, FOR THE RECORD is an unconventional production that brings the soul of treasured directors' films front and center: the soundtrack. Staged in intimate venues that immerse the audience in the excitement, carefully-selected songs from movie soundtracks are brought to life. A mix of part rock-concert part theater, For The Record unites characters across a film directors' cannon into one world. In 2010, the immersive experience began in a 60-seat bar in Hollywood and has featured the works of acclaimed directors Quentin Tarantino, John Hughes, Baz Luhrmann, The Coen Brothers, Paul Thomas Anderson, Martin Scorsese, Robert Zemeckis, and Garry and Penny Marshall. For The Record has performed around the country with shows in Los Angeles, Las Vegas (a three-year run with Cirque du Soleil and The Venetian), New York, Chicago, Indianapolis, The Ace Hotel in Palm Springs, SXSW in Austin, TX, The Montreal International Jazz Festival and currently making waves on Norwegian Cruise Line's mega-ship, The Escape.
